First check that the hinge screws are tight.
If your door rubs near the top or drags on the floor use a screwdriver not a drill to tighten the screws.
Make sure all the screws are tight.
Check that the door fits correctly.
Open the door grasp it by the lock edge and move it up and down.
With a drill you re more likely to over tighten the screw and strip the screw holes or chew up the screwheads.
Tightening the door hinges may solve the problem by pulling the door back toward the jamb the hinged part of the frame so it no longer catches on the frame when you try to close it.
